UART (المرسل الموزع غير المتزامن) هو بروتوكول توصيلي هاردوير مستخدم على نطاق واسع يتيح التواصل السلسل غير المتزامن بين الأجهزة. إنه ضروري في النظم المتكاملة، والميكروكنترولر، والأجهزة الإلكترونية المختلفة للنقل البياني. تشمل وظائف UART الأساسية ما يلي:
1. التواصل غير المتزامن: على عكس البروتوكولات المتزامنة، لا يتطلب UART إشارة ساعة للتنسيق. بدلاً من ذلك، يستخدم بيانات البداية والانتهاء لتكوين البيانات، مما يسمح للأجهزة بالتواصل دون ساعة مشتركة.
2. تكوين البيانات: يتم نقل البيانات في إطارات، عادة ما تتكون من بيانات البداية، عدد معين من بيانات البيانات (عادة ما يكون بين 5 إلى 9)، بيانات اختيارية للتمييز لتحقق من الأخطاء، وبعض بيانات الانتهاء لتحديد نهاية النقل.
3. التواصل المزدوج الاتجاه: يدعم UART النقل والاستقبال المتزامن للبيانات، مما يتيح التواصل المزدوج الاتجاه، وهو ضروري للعديد من التطبيقات.
4. معدل النقل: يتم تعريف سرعة نقل البيانات بمعدل النقل، الذي يشير إلى عدد التغيرات في الإشارات (الرموز) في الثانية. تشمل معدلات النقل الشائعة 9600، 115200، وما إلى ذلك، بناءً على متطلبات التطبيق.
| 1. نقل البيانات الاستقبال | |
| 2. الكشف عن الأخطاء | |
| 3. التحكم في التدفق | |
| 4. الإعداد | |
| 5. الاستدعاءات والمحافظ | |
| 1. التواصل مع الميكروكنترولر | |
| 2. دمج وحدة GPS | |
| 3. التواصل اللاسلكي | |
| 4. التشخيص والسجلات | |
| 5. التحكم في التشغيل الصناعي |
بقى UART تقنية أساسية في التواصل السلس، يقدم بساطة وإنتاجية عبر مجموعة واسعة من التطبيقات. تعد مرونته في مجالات مثل الأجهزة الإستهلاكية، التحكم الصناعي، والشبكات الذكية تبرز أهميته في النظم المتكاملة الحديثة. فهم وظائف UART الأساسية وتطبيقاتها العملية يمكن أن يرفع من تطوير أنظمة تواصل موثوقة وفعالة، مما يجعله عنصرًا حيويًا في تصميم الأجهزة الإلكترونية.